Joining Forces to Fight Diabetes
Lions work with the National Diabetes Education Program (NDEP) to promote diabetes awareness. NDEP is a leading public education program that promotes diabetes prevention and control in the USA. NDEP also provides diabetes resources and publications.
We also commemorate World Diabetes Day, an annual campaign led by the International Diabetes Federation on November 14. Lions often facilitate diabetes community awareness events on this day.

Ten million Ethiopians at risk of trachoma received doses of the sight-saving drug azithromycin during a week-long distribution program supported by LCIF, Lions of Ethiopia, the Ethiopian government, Pfizer Inc., The Carter Center and other organizations.
